A call to celebration

Despite a week of gloomy weather forecasts, the sun broke through to shine on the Class of 2014, the largest in Skidmore history, during the College’s 103rd commencement. The 712 bachelors degree recipients in the Class of 2014—a group that had a profound impact on Skidmore over the past four years—exuberantly walked across the stage to applause, cheers, and a few tears of happiness from the thousands of family and friends in attendance May 17 at the Saratoga Performing Arts Center.
